Why Sunrise Manor’s Climate & Housing Affect Air Duct Cleaning
Sunrise Manor sits on the exposed northeastern rim of the Las Vegas Valley, hard against open Mojave Desert and the undeveloped terrain around Frenchman Mountain. That positioning matters more than most residents realize. When haboobs roll through, they hit Sunrise Manor before winds lose momentum over denser development to the west. The result is measurably higher concentrations of fine caliche dust and silica particles entering homes here than in master-planned interior neighborhoods.
The housing stock compounds the problem. The 89115 ZIP is dominated by single-story ranch homes built between 1960 and 1985, most with original sheet-metal trunk-and-branch ductwork running through unconditioned attics. Those attics exceed 150°F regularly in summer. That heat degrades flex-duct connections and mastic seals quickly, creating gaps that pull unfiltered desert air directly into the supply side. Low humidity means dust doesn’t clump and fall out of suspension; it stays airborne longer and penetrates deeper before settling.
Our technicians working the east side near Nellis Boulevard frequently find return-air boxes packed with a distinctive reddish-tan caliche powder. This mineral-rich desert soil is fine enough to bypass the 1-inch fiberglass filters common in older 1970s-era AHUs, building into a compacted layer that chokes airflow before most homeowners notice a comfort problem. Cleaning these systems properly requires equipment that can agitate and extract material that has essentially become part of the duct surface, not just vacuum loose debris.

In Sunrise Manor’s 1960s-1980s housing, original sheet-metal trunk lines are often sound; it’s the flex-duct connections and mastic seals that fail in attic heat. Repairing and sealing these is typically one-third to one-half the cost of full replacement, and it solves the infiltration problem if the trunk itself is intact.
